What is a Chemical Peel?
A chemical peel uses carefully selected exfoliating ingredients to help loosen and remove dull, damaged surface cells. This encourages fresher, healthier-looking skin to come forward and can improve the appearance of skin tone, texture, clarity, and radiance.
Depending on the peel selected, treatment may help improve the look of:
- Dull or tired-looking skin
- Uneven skin tone
- Rough texture
- Congested pores
- Acne-prone skin
- Fine lines
- Sun damage
- Pigmentation concerns
- Loss of radiance
- Dry or dehydrated-looking skin
The right peel depends on your skin. That is why we begin with a professional skin assessment before recommending the best option for your concerns.

ZO® Stimulator Peel
The ZO® Stimulator Peel is often called the “Red Carpet Peel” because it is designed to brighten, smooth, and refresh the skin with minimal visible downtime.
This is a popular option for patients who want a professional glow before an event, a seasonal skin refresh, or an ongoing maintenance treatment to support skin clarity and radiance.
Benefits of the ZO® Stimulator Peel
The ZO® Stimulator Peel may help:
- Brighten dull-looking skin
- Smooth rough texture
- Improve the appearance of uneven tone
- Refresh tired or lacklustre skin
- Support clearer-looking pores
- Improve skin radiance
- Provide a polished glow with minimal downtime
This peel uses a combination of exfoliating acids, including lactic, citric, and glycolic acids, to gently resurface the skin and support a brighter, smoother complexion.

Chemical Peels vs. Regular Facials
A regular facial may help cleanse, hydrate, and temporarily refresh the skin. A professional chemical peel is more targeted.
Chemical peels are designed to create controlled exfoliation using clinical-grade ingredients. This allows the treatment to address concerns such as texture, congestion, dullness, uneven tone, and early visible signs of aging more directly than a basic facial.

Who Is a Good Candidate for a Chemical Peel?
Chemical peels may be suitable for patients who want to improve the appearance of:
- Dull skin
- Uneven tone
- Rough texture
- Fine lines
- Congested pores
- Acne-prone skin
- Sun damage
- Pigmentation concerns
- General loss of glow
A consultation is recommended to determine which peel is most appropriate for your skin. Some patients may need to pause certain active skincare ingredients before treatment, while others may benefit from preparing the skin with a professional skincare routine first.
Chemical peels may not be appropriate if your skin is irritated, compromised, recently sunburned, or if you are using certain medications or aggressive topical products. Your provider will review this with you before treatment.
What to Expect During Treatment
Your appointment begins with a skin assessment and discussion of your concerns, current skincare routine, sensitivity, and treatment goals.
Your provider will then cleanse and prepare the skin before applying the selected peel or treatment products. You may feel mild tingling, warmth, or tightness during the treatment, depending on the peel used and your skin’s sensitivity.
After treatment, your skin may look brighter and refreshed. Some peels involve little to no visible peeling, while others may cause temporary dryness, flaking, redness, or sensitivity. Your provider will explain what to expect based on the specific treatment selected for you.
How to Prepare for a Chemical Peel
Before your chemical peel, your provider may recommend that you:
- Stop retinol, Retin-A, or other active exfoliating products before treatment as directed
- Avoid aggressive scrubs, exfoliants, peels, or masks before your appointment
- Avoid tanning or excessive sun exposure
- Let your provider know if you are using Accutane, isotretinoin, prescription acne medications, or strong topical products
- Arrive with clean skin if possible
Preparation may vary depending on your skin and the type of peel being performed.
Chemical Peel Aftercare
After a chemical peel, your skin may be more sensitive than usual. Proper aftercare helps protect your results and reduce unnecessary irritation.
After treatment, you should generally:
- Avoid direct sun exposure
- Wear broad-spectrum sunscreen daily
- Avoid saunas, steam rooms, hot yoga, tanning beds, and excessive heat for at least 48 hours
- Avoid retinol, exfoliating acids, scrubs, and aggressive skincare until cleared by your provider
- Keep the skin moisturized and hydrated
- Do not pick or pull at any flaking skin
- Follow the post-care instructions provided by your treatment provider
Sunscreen is non-negotiable after a peel. This is not the time to freestyle your skincare routine.
How Many Chemical Peels Will I Need?
Some patients notice a refreshed glow after one treatment, especially with lighter peels such as the ZO® Stimulator Peel. For concerns such as acne-prone skin, texture, pigmentation, or long-term skin rejuvenation, a series of treatments may be recommended.
Your provider will recommend a treatment plan based on your skin, your goals, and how your skin responds.
